what is magnetization?​

Respuesta :

sabkijaan
sabkijaan sabkijaan
  • 01-02-2022

Answer:

In classical electromagnetism, magnetization is the vector field that expresses the density of permanent or induced magnetic dipole moments in a magnetic material. Movement within this field is described by direction and is either Axial or Diametric
